Re: Anyone else a smoker?

I smoke.

My doc told me to quit at least two weeks before surgery, of course.

I tried but my nerves wouldn't allow it. I didn't smoke the morning of surgery though.

I was in the hospital 2 1/2 days and didn't even think about a cig.

Started back as soon as I got home.

I did read that smoking constricts the blood vessels and that does slow healing down since blood flow is important to heal.

It also puts high levels of carbon dioxide/monoxide? in you, which can affect your oxygen levels while under anesthesia. It can also have an impact on developing pneumonia afterwards.

So there is a health risk with smoking, surgery and recovery, along with the other health risks just on a daily basis.

I plan to quit again. I am getting to the point of disliking the taste and smell.

I truly feel, if I wasn't smoking, I'd be feeling even better than I do right now.
